PageTypes CMS v4.0 Release
Posted By: Dimitar Dyulgerski on 3/16/2012 4:50:44 PM, 0 Comments, 475 Views Categories: PageTypes Versioning Tags: release, features, updates, version 4.0

Since version 4.0 we are changing our sales practice. PageTypes CMS is now available for download with remote licensing policy. You can download PageTypes installer and following a few simple steps you can setup a website on your own server.
Since PageTypes CMS is now available outside PageTypes hosting environment the new version is coming with system backup schedule functionality and automatic updates. PageTypes customers can configure backup plans on their websites and what is more important their websites will be always up to date using automatic updates. All the new features, fixes and browser adjustments are coming to your website directly from PageTypes development team at no additional fees.


Almost forgot, PageTypes CMS has FREE version now. You can install PageTypes CMS and use it for free with limited page types available. Check what free version contains.

For those of you who follow PageTypes, we are braking the normal version sequence and we are jumping from version 3.2 to 4.0. I want to thank you all for being with us, for your feedback and for your help making PageTypes CMS really useful software product.

PageTypes CMS v3.2 Release Notes
Posted By: Dimitar Dyulgerski on 10/6/2011 4:05:36 PM, 0 Comments, 1888 Views Categories: PageTypes Versioning Tags: release, features, updates, version 3.2
PageTypes CMS v3.2 is coming with more social buttons and Facebook login integration, some fixes and improvements applied too.

New Features

  • Facebook "Like" button added to all page items of type News, Events, Products, Services, Video, Image Gallery, Blog posts. The button is also added to all pages of type content. The button is toggled on or off from the corresponding page setting - Enable Facebook "Like" button. Like button let users share your content with friends on Facebook. When the user clicks the Like button on your site, a story appears in his Facebook profile with a link back to your website. If you wish to get detailed analytics about the demographics of your users you can link your site to Facebook application.
